About Rickturnerite
Formula:
Pb7O4[Mg(OH)4](OH)Cl3
Colour:
white to pale green
Crystal System:
Orthorhombic
Name:
Named in honor of Richard William "Rick" Turner (1958 - 14 October 2020), British mineral collector, mining engineer and technology consultant. He was an expert on the Mendip Hills and discovered the mineral in 2005. He also served as President of the Russell Society.

Crystallography of Rickturnerite
Crystal System:
Orthorhombic
Class (H-M):
mmm(2/m2/m2/m) - Dipyramidal
Space Group:
Pnma
Cell Parameters:
a = 25.879(3) Å, b = 5.8024(6) Å, c = 22.717(2) Å
Ratio:
a:b:c = 4.46 : 1 : 3.915
Unit Cell V:
3,411.19 ų (Calculated from Unit Cell)
